A well-structured React Native Boilerplate with Typescript, Redux, Jest & Enzyme support and everything you'll ever need to deploy rock solid apps.

Overview

Building mobile apps can be a complex task, especially when it comes to integrating various technologies. This well-structured React Native Boilerplate simplifies the process by combining TypeScript, Redux, Jest, and Enzyme. It provides all the essential tools required for deploying robust applications, allowing developers to focus on creating unique functionalities rather than starting from scratch.

With React Native's efficient approach to mobile development, this boilerplate ensures seamless code sharing across iOS, Android, and the web. It’s designed for both novice and experienced developers looking to kick-start their projects with a solid foundation.

Features

  • TypeScript Support: Offers optional static typing, classes, and interfaces, enhancing code quality and maintainability.
  • React Navigation: Provides built-in navigators for a seamless navigation experience right out of the box.
  • Redux & Redux Persist: Effective state management system with the ability to persist and rehydrate the Redux store.
  • Styled Components: Allows the use of plain CSS within components, preventing class name collisions and providing a scoped styling experience.
  • Babel Integration: Utilizes the latest JavaScript features with module alias support for cleaner imports.
  • CodePush: Enables real-time updates for mobile apps, ensuring users always have the latest version without needing to manually download updates.
  • React Native SVG Support: Facilitates the use of SVG graphics on both iOS and Android devices for enhanced visual aesthetics.
  • Jest and Enzyme Support: Offers a complete testing solution that works out of the box for any React project, ensuring code reliability and performance.

React

React is a widely used JavaScript library for building user interfaces and single-page applications. It follows a component-based architecture and uses a virtual DOM to efficiently update and render UI components

React Native

React Native is a framework for building mobile applications using React and JavaScript. It enables developers to write once and deploy to multiple platforms, including iOS, Android, and the web, while providing a native app-like experience to users.

Styled Components

Styled Components is a popular library for styling React components using CSS syntax. It allows you to write CSS in your JavaScript code, making it easier to create dynamic styles that are specific to each component.

Eslint

ESLint is a linter for JavaScript that analyzes code to detect and report on potential problems and errors, as well as enforce consistent code style and best practices, helping developers to write cleaner, more maintainable code.

Redux

Redux is a state management library for JavaScript apps that provides a predictable and centralized way to manage application state. It enables developers to write actions and reducers that update the state in response to user interactions, server responses, and other events, and can be used with a variety of front-end frameworks and back-end technologies.

Typescript

TypeScript is a superset of JavaScript, providing optional static typing, classes, interfaces, and other features that help developers write more maintainable and scalable code. TypeScript's static typing system can catch errors at compile-time, making it easier to build and maintain large applications.
